Who is likely to be promoted to KPL? | National Super League

With only few matches to the end of the 2018/19 NSL season, thirty six rounds gone and only one point separates the top three sides – Wazito FC (75 points), Kisumu All Stars (74 points) and Nairobi Stima (74) as Ushuru comes fourth with 70 points

Its up to the top 3 teams to prove themselves worthy for the promotion to Kenyan Premier League (KPL) with only two matches left for each team.

Wazito might assure themselves of a place in next year’s top flight if they win against FC Talanta at the Camp Toyoyo if Kisumu All Stars and Stima drop points.

If all the top three win their games, then the race for promotion will head to the final day. Also, Ushuru’s race for promotion will come to an end for a third consecutive season.
